Output ebf6597956de81d5159fc2fbb02ecd65ef184f3b4e7997828e0e58b62569d61d:0

value
30655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ed81c972c56800d6c3b91b6136feef9dec5feb86 OP_EQUAL
address
3PLqYm2rihWmFcZE7sUsxPxZqTgD2mpwNp
transaction
ebf6597956de81d5159fc2fbb02ecd65ef184f3b4e7997828e0e58b62569d61d